<?xml version="1.0" encoding="utf-8"?><?xml-stylesheet title="XSL formatting" type="text/xsl" href="http://blog.kryskool.org/index.php/feed/rss2/xslt" ?><rss version="2.0"
  xmlns:dc="http://purl.org/dc/elements/1.1/"
  xmlns:wfw="http://wellformedweb.org/CommentAPI/"
  xmlns:content="http://purl.org/rss/1.0/modules/content/">
<channel>
  <title>Le Monde de KrysKool - script</title>
  <link>http://blog.kryskool.org/index.php/</link>
  <description>Mon blog</description>
  <language>fr</language>
  <copyright>KrysKool.org &amp;copy;</copyright>
  <docs>http://blogs.law.harvard.edu/tech/rss</docs>
  <generator>DotClear</generator>
  
    
  <item>
    <title>Effacer les contenus des tables d'un schéma</title>
    <link>http://blog.kryskool.org/index.php/post/2007/05/22/Effacer-les-contenus-des-tables-dun-schema</link>
    <guid isPermaLink="false">urn:md5:9e1d97b56b73b4e444c7753d34df8066</guid>
    <pubDate>Tue, 22 May 2007 22:00:00 +0200</pubDate>
    <dc:creator>KrysKool</dc:creator>
        <category>postgresql</category>
        <category>postgresql</category><category>script</category>    
    <description>
    Il est parfois utile d'effacer tous les jeux de test que l'on a effectué de la base de données avant le démarrage en production. le script ci dessous est à rejouer une fois celui-ci enregistrer        </description>
    <content:encoded>&lt;p&gt;Il est parfois utile d'effacer tous les jeux de test que l'on a effectué de la base de données avant le démarrage en production. le script ci dessous est à rejouer une fois celui-ci enregistrer&lt;/p&gt;    &lt;p&gt;Le script ci dessous construit un fichier qui ferra un &lt;a href=&quot;http://docs.postgresqlfr.org/8.2/sql-truncate.html&quot; hreflang=&quot;fr&quot; title=&quot;TRUNCATE TABLE&quot;&gt;TRUNCATE&lt;/a&gt; des tables du schéma sélectionné.&lt;/p&gt;

&lt;pre&gt;
SELECT 'TRUNCATE TABLE '||table_schema||'.'||table_name||';'
FROM   information_schema.tables 
WHERE  table_type='BASE TABLE' 
AND    table_schema='public';
&lt;/pre&gt;


&lt;p&gt;cela donnera le résultat ci dessous.&lt;/p&gt;
&lt;pre&gt;
TRUNCATE TABLE public.table1;
TRUNCATE TABLE public.table2;
TRUNCATE TABLE public.table3;
&lt;/pre&gt;



&lt;p&gt;enregistrer ce script et rejouer le.&lt;/p&gt;</content:encoded>
    
    

    <comments>http://blog.kryskool.org/index.php/post/2007/05/22/Effacer-les-contenus-des-tables-dun-schema#comment-form</comments>
    <wfw:comment>http://blog.kryskool.org/index.php/post/2007/05/22/Effacer-les-contenus-des-tables-dun-schema#comment-form</wfw:comment>
    <wfw:commentRss>http://blog.kryskool.org/index.php/feed/rss2/comments/13</wfw:commentRss>
  </item>
    
</channel>
</rss>